English > infestation: 2 senses > noun 1, state| Meaning | The state of being invaded or overrun by parasites. |
|---|
| Narrower | Guinea worm disease, Guinea worm, dracunculiasis | A painful and debilitating infestation contracted by drinking stagnant water contaminated with Guinea worm larvae that can mature inside a human's abdomen until the worm emerges through a painful blister in the person's skin |
|---|
| acariasis, acariosis, acaridiasis | infestation with itch mites |
| ascariasis | infestation of the human intestine with Ascaris roundworms |
| coccidiosis | (veterinary medicine) infestation with coccidia |
| echinococcosis, hydatid disease, hydatidosis | infestation with larval echinococci (tapeworms) |
| enterobiasis | An infestation with or a resulting infection caused by the pinworm Enterobius vermicularis |
| fascioliasis, fasciolosis | infestation with the liver fluke Fasciola hepatica |
| fasciolopsiasis | infestation with the large intestinal fluke Fasciolopsis buski |
| helminthiasis | infestation of the body with parasitic worms |
| myiasis | infestation of the body by the larvae of flies (usually through a wound or other opening) or any disease resulting from such infestation |
| onchocerciasis, river blindness | infestation with slender threadlike roundworms (filaria) deposited under the skin by the bite of black fleas |
| opisthorchiasis | infestation with flukes obtained from eating raw fish |
| pediculosis, lousiness | infestation with lice (Pediculus humanus) resulting in severe itching |
| schistosomiasis, bilharzia, bilharziasis | An infestation with or a resulting infection caused by a parasite of the genus Schistosoma |
| trichinosis, trichiniasis, myositis trichinosa | infestation by trichina larvae that are transmitted by eating inadequately cooked meat (especially pork) |
| trichuriasis | infestation by a roundworm |
| trombiculiasis | infestation with chiggers |
